''Left Alive'' is a ThirdPersonShooter developed by ilinx and Silicon Studio (a pair of development team that primarily focused on mobile games), published by Creator/SquareEnix for the UsefulNotes/PS4 and PC. The game was directed by [[VideoGame/ArmoredCore Toshifumi Nabeshima]] and produced by [[Franchise/FinalFantasy Shinji Hashimoto]], with character design by [[Videogame/MetalGear Yoji Shinkawa]] and mechanical designs by [[VideoGame/XenobladeChroniclesX Takayuki]] [[Anime/MobileSuitGundam00 Yanase]].

* ResourcesManagementGameplay: Ammo and healing are quite scarce, enemies take a lot of hits (headshots and usage of craftable bombs are essential for not running out of ammo), and crafting resources are finite. The game's resource management is much closer to ''Franchise/ResidentEvil'' than ''[[Franchise/MetalGear Metal Gear Solid]]''.

* ObviousBeta: Besides the AI bugs, the release version of the game is known for severe FPS dips during the Wanzer sections, and for frequent crashing due to memory leaks. Other glitches include textures failing to render completely and enemy squads falling through the environmental objects.
